+ SRU Justification
+ 
+     Impact:
+        The upstream process for stable tree updates is quite similar
+        in scope to the Ubuntu SRU process, e.g., each patch has to
+        demonstrably fix a bug, and each patch is vetted by upstream
+        by originating either directly from a mainline/stable Linux tree or
+        a minimally backported form of that patch. The following upstream
+        stable patches should be included in the Ubuntu kernel:
+ 
+        upstream stable patchset 2020-09-02
+ 
+                 Ported from the following upstream stable releases:
+                         v4.14.194, v4.19.140,
+                                    v4.19.141
+ 
+        from git://git.kernel.org/
